Output 52c489d99dd441bcfd1c726fa8f80f0a71a7941733fbe486d359c93bc4524bf3:8

value
2338760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b49bf88a4f4d3514825081fb72e24ae85bf7c8e3 OP_EQUAL
address
3J9zQ7qDiasUckxZmqhjEFBrfoEHUDmRU6
transaction
52c489d99dd441bcfd1c726fa8f80f0a71a7941733fbe486d359c93bc4524bf3